Sphingomonas flava es una bacteria gramnegativa de pigmentación amarilla de la familia Sphingomonadaceae. Habita en entornos de suelo y agua dulce y, como otros miembros del género, posee esfingolípidos en su membrana externa que la distinguen de la mayoría de las otras bacterias gramnegativas. Su estado de conservación no ha sido evaluado.
